Description of Operation
In contrast to chargers with voltage/current characteristic, this charger uses constant current. This means
that charging is considerably faster, as the battery is charged with the maximum current right up to the end
of the charging process. The batteries also receive a 100-% charge.
Controlled gassing is desirable in this, as it has a major influence on the formation of sulphate layers, thus
prolonging the service life of the battery.
Charging principle: up to a voltage of 14.7V or 7.3V in 6V batteries, the battery is charged with the
maximum current. Then the charger switches to the timer mode and the battery is charged with constantly
decreasing current. After approx. 1 hour the charger switches automatically to the stand-by mode and
trickle charging at 13.8 V or 6,9V in 6V batteries is initiated. Also suitable for the charging of lead gel
batteries. The charger is, of course, protected against short circuiting and polarity reversal.
LED indicators
red:
red:
operating indicator – as soon as a battery is connected, the unit charges with maximum current:
yellow: timer mode – the battery voltage has reached 14.7V or 7.3V. It is then charged for approx. 1
hour with constantly decreasing current (see diagram).
green:
charging is complete and the unit is in "trickle charge" mode.
Security Information
When the charge is completed (the battery is full) the green LED lights.
It is possible to charge batteries with different capacities. For larger batteries the charge time is longer, for
smaller batteries the charge time is shorter.
Batteries may be charged whether they are weak or completely low. The battery can also be continually
connected to the charger but the temperature of the environment should never be exceeded not drop
below 20-25°C. If the battery is inadvertently connected to the charger at the wrong pole/terminal then the
flow of energy will be discontinued. If the poles are reversed by mistake on connection of the battery to the
charger, the charging current is shut down.
